Choosing amongst solar providers in Concord is not actually regarding locating the company with the flashiest ad or the most affordable intro cost. It is about finding a specialist that understands your roof covering, your energy bill, your long-lasting ownership plans, and the local permitting and inspection process all right to develop a system that carries out for 25 years, not simply for the very first sunny month.

That distinction matters greater than lots of property owners anticipate. Solar is offered as a basic upgrade, however the real purchase acts more like a roofing system task, an electrical job, and a lasting economic decision rolled right into one. The best regional solar companies know that. They ask much better inquiries, they catch concerns early, and they are sincere about compromises. The weak ones concentrate on getting a trademark and ironing out the information later.

If you have been searching for solar firms, solar business near me, or solar energy companies near me, you have probably seen just how crowded the field is. National brands, local installers, sales-only outfits, roofing companies that additionally install solar, and brokerage-style companies all complete for the same property owner. Some do excellent work. Some subcontract nearly every little thing. Some provide an extremely eye-catching monthly repayment that just looks appealing till you read the escalator and charge structure.

The great information is that you do not require to be a solar designer to sort via the options. You do need a clear way to judge them.

What makes a solar firm "leading" in Concord

The toughest solar firms Concord property owners pick tend to share a couple of practices. They are receptive, however not aggressive. They explain style options in ordinary language. They discuss offset, payback, and manufacturing with some humbleness since those numbers depend upon weather condition, shading, energy prices, and your real power use. They likewise understand exactly how to take care of the less glamorous components of the job, including permit corrections, utility documentation, and service phone calls after installation.

A leading provider generally masters 5 areas at once: system design, installment high quality, equipment option, financial openness, and post-install support. The majority of weak experiences can be mapped back to one of those locations breaking down.

Consider a common instance. 2 business bid on the very same residence. One offers a bigger system with a lower headline price. The other suggests a slightly smaller sized array, describes that the north-facing roofing system aircraft is a poor production area, and suggests making use of the much better south- and west-facing roofing areas rather. The first bid might look stronger theoretically. The second firm is often the better partner due to the fact that it is designing for output, not panel count.

That kind of judgment is what divides an actual neighborhood specialist from a sales company functioning from a script.

Start with your residence, not the salesman's pitch

The right solar system begins with your home's specifics. If your roof is nearing completion of its life, that need to become part of the solar conversation on the first day. If you anticipate to buy an electric vehicle in the next two years, your production target might require to be bigger than your previous year of electrical expenses suggest. If your home is home throughout the day, your usage pattern may aim toward a various battery method than a family members that is away until evening.

Good solar carriers hang around on these details. Weak ones jump right to a financing solar company Concord slide.

I have seen home owners obtain thrilled by a proposition appealing near-total bill elimination, just to find that the style disregarded a big shaded area of the roof, or presumed future energy regulations too kindly, or utilized yearly production price quotes that did not match the roof covering positioning. A proposition is just as trustworthy as the site assessment behind it.

This is why the "solar companies near me" search ought to result in conversations, not simply quote forms. You want someone who can take a look at your roofing system and inform you what is convenient, what mishandles, and what is unworthy doing.

The quote that looks least expensive typically costs more

This is one of the earliest patterns in household contracting, and solar is no exemption. A reduced bid may hide thinner margins for solution, an inexperienced set up crew, a rushed style, lower-grade placing equipment, or funding terms that reshape the economics. Sometimes the firm is simply betting that you will certainly not contrast information carefully.

When you review solar business, contrast the whole plan, not simply the system price or monthly repayment. Production approximates matter. So does the equipment mix. So does the handiwork guarantee, roof penetration technique, panel layout, checking system, and what happens if one part falls short 10 years from now.

A monthly payment can be particularly misleading. A system funded over a long term might show a comfortable regular monthly number while setting you back far more total. Some loans additionally consist of dealer charges that considerably raise the effective project rate. Those fees are not always a dealbreaker, yet they ought to be gone over openly.

The far better companies usually invite this comparison. They understand they might not be the most affordable line item, and they are prepared to reveal why.

The tools discussion must seem practical, not theatrical

Solar sales discussions often lean also tough on brand. Devices matters, however not in the means lots of house owners are led to believe. A costs panel from a popular supplier can be a great choice, especially when roof covering room is minimal and higher efficiency assists. Yet a trusted mid-tier panel set up properly on the best roof covering can also do extremely well.

The exact same goes with inverters and batteries. The very best option depends on your roofing layout, shade conditions, keeping an eye on preferences, and whether strength throughout blackouts is a top priority. A leading installer describes these choices in the context of your house.

Here is where experience shows. On a basic, unshaded roof, one devices configuration might be cost-efficient and dependable for decades. On a roof covering with numerous faces, smokeshafts, partial shading, or complex manufacturing zones, module-level power electronics might make even more sense. Neither choice is universally superior. The ideal service provider discusses the compromise instead of transforming it into a one-brand sermon.

You must likewise take note of serviceability. Fancy equipment is less outstanding if neighborhood support is weak or replacement timelines are slow. The installer's connection with producers, and its own willingness to troubleshoot problems after commissioning, matter greater than a marketing brochure.

Financing can make a great system appearance negative, or a negative system look good

Many acquiring mistakes happen here. Property owners typically focus so heavily on obtaining listed below their present energy costs that they disregard car loan costs, escalator conditions, prepayment presumptions, and tax-credit timing. A strong installer or expert will certainly slow down the conversation down and ensure the monetary framework matches your goals.

If you intend to remain in your home long term and can buy the system outright, cash money normally provides the clearest business economics. If you favor to protect liquidity, a car loan might still work well, but you require to understand the total cost. Lease and power acquisition structures can decrease ahead of time cost, yet they can additionally make complex a home sale or decrease long-lasting cost savings, relying on terms.

None of these courses are instantly wrong. They merely serve different priorities.

One property owner may value maximum life time return and select possession. An additional may value immediate cash flow relief and approve reduced long-term advantage. The concern is not whether one design is ethically remarkable. The issue is whether the company is revealing you the genuine trade-offs without dressing them up.

If a salesman rushes previous tax obligation credit history assumptions, transfer terms, yearly repayment increases, or what takes place if you sell your home in seven years, that is not a small noninclusion. It is the financial core of the project.

Batteries are manual, and that is okay

Battery storage space is among the most misconstrued parts of the modern-day solar conversation. Some property owners absolutely benefit from it. Others are better served by solar alone, at least for now. The appropriate solution relies on outage frequency, energy rate structure, backup priorities, and budget.

If your area sees regular power disruptions, batteries can include genuine resilience. If your energy billing setup positions a premium on changing stored power right into higher-value night usage, they may improve the project business economics. If you mainly desire the quickest repayment and failures are uncommon, the battery may extend the timeline more than you are comfortable with.

A fully grown service provider will certainly not deal with batteries as a mandatory upsell or a trick. It will certainly ask what you really desire supported. Whole-home back-up is a really different scope from sustaining refrigeration, internet, lights, and a few circuits. Those differences impact equipment dimension, cost, and owner satisfaction.

This is an additional factor where practical layout matters more than broad claims. The most effective solar business are generally specific here. They talk about lots planning, not simply energy independence.

Installation high quality is usually concealed up until it is not

Many property owners not surprisingly concentrate on panels and rate due to solar energy the fact that those are visible and very easy to compare. Yet workmanship often determines whether the project continues to solar site assessment be monotonous, in the most effective feasible means, for the following two decades.

Quality installation turns up in blinking details, avenue routing, attachment spacing, panel placement, electric labeling, and clean commissioning. You might not notice every one of those items throughout the sales procedure, yet they affect roofing honesty, appearance, evaluation outcomes, and long-lasting reliability.

Ask for photos of recent regional jobs. Not simply the beauty shots from the road, but close-ups of roofing system accessories, channel runs, and the ended up electrical work. Excellent installers are frequently honored to share these due to the fact that clean work promotes itself.

It is also wise to ask what the business does if your roofing requires attention before installation. Some solar companies work smoothly with roofing companions. Others leave home owners stuck between professions. If your roof has less than 10 years of most likely life left, the solar choice and roof covering decision must be discussed together.

Questions that create sincere answers

When you take a seat with a service provider, the ideal questions can transform a polished pitch right into a valuable conversation. Ask them calmly and let the business show you exactly how it thinks.

First, ask what percentage of your annual usage the system is created to counter and why that target was selected. Then ask what presumptions were made use of in the manufacturing design. A good solution discusses roofing alignment, shading, weather patterns, and your current intake, not just "average financial savings."

Next, ask who manages service if the tracking system flags an issue after setup. If the solution appears vague, that is details. Ask whether the business makes use of subcontractors and, if so, for which components of the work. Ask what takes place if the roof covering needs substitute later. Ask how funding impacts the complete task cost. Ask what the craftsmanship service warranty covers in sensible terms.

You are not attempting to question anybody. You are listening for uniqueness. Major specialists normally invite it.

Does rain affect solar panels in Concord?

Rain and associated cloud cover generally reduce solar electricity production because less sunlight reaches the panels. Solar panels can still generate electricity during rainy weather when daylight is available. Rain may also wash away light dust and debris from the panel surface. Electricity production normally increases again when skies clear.

Who pays the best price for solar energy in Concord?

The amount paid for electricity exported from a solar system depends on the applicable utility tariff and solar billing program. Compensation can vary by time of day, grid conditions, and the customer's rate plan. Electricity consumed directly in the home may have greater financial value than electricity exported to the grid. Current utility rules determine the actual compensation received.

Who gives the best rate for solar panels in Concord?

The best solar installation rate varies according to system size, equipment, financing, roof conditions, and installation requirements. Comparing several written proposals using similar specifications provides a more accurate price comparison. Cost per watt can help compare similarly equipped systems of different sizes. Financing charges and warranty coverage should also be considered when evaluating total cost.

How to get the best deal on solar in Concord?

A competitive solar deal generally requires comparing several written proposals with similar equipment and system capacities. Important factors include cash price, cost per watt, financing charges, warranties, and estimated annual electricity production. Oversizing the system or adding unnecessary equipment can increase costs without providing proportional benefits. Comparing total lifetime costs provides a clearer assessment than monthly payments alone.
